Inteligență artificială

Alibaba lansează Qwen3-Coder: AI open-source pentru generare autonomă de cod

mm
Alibaba Debuts Qwen3-Coder: Open-Source AI for Autonomous Code Generation

Inteligenta artificială (AI) a evoluat de la funcții de bază, cum ar fi conversația și generarea de text, la roluri mai avansate în domenii specializate. Acum, se dezvoltă în sisteme care pot acționa ca asistenți de codare, capabili să planifice, să genereze și să testeze software-ul în mod autonom.

La 23 iulie 2025, Alibaba a introdus Qwen3-Coder, un model open-source pentru generare autonomă de cod. Proiectul este disponibil pe GitHub sub QwenLM/Qwen3-Coder, iar dezvoltatorii din întreaga lume pot accesa și utiliza gratuit.

Acest lansare reprezintă un pas important în utilizarea AI open-source pentru dezvoltarea de software. Modelele de codare deschise, cum ar fi Qwen3-Coder, încep să concureze cu sistemele comerciale închise. Mai mult, dezvoltatorii caută acum instrumente care oferă viteză, acuratețe și transparență. Prin urmare, Qwen3-Coder a fost creat pentru a îndeplini aceste nevoi și introduce funcții de AI agențice pentru a gestiona sarcini de programare complexe.

Ce este Qwen3-Coder?

Qwen3-Coder face parte din seria de modele Qwen dezvoltate de Alibaba. Versiunea anterioară, Qwen2.5, a fost lansată în 2024 și a demonstrat deja o performanță puternică în ambele sarcini de limbaj și codare. Similar, Qwen3-Coder se bazează pe această fundație, dar are o focalizare mai mare pe programare.

Modelul este oferit în diferite dimensiuni. Versiunea cea mai mare conține 480 de miliarde de parametri, dar doar 35 de miliarde sunt active în timpul inferenței. Prin urmare, poate captura modele de codare complexe, menținând în același timp utilizarea eficientă a resurselor. Acest design asigură că atât acuratețea, cât și viteza sunt menținute.

Mai mult, Alibaba a antrenat Qwen3-Coder pe o gamă largă de limbi de programare. Suportă limbile utilizate în mod obișnuit, cum ar fi Python, Java și C++, și acoperă, de asemenea, limbile pentru domenii mai specializate. Ca urmare, modelul poate susține diverse grupuri de dezvoltatori, inclusiv dezvoltatori web, ingineri de sisteme încorporate, specialiști în pipeline-uri de date și echipe de software enterprise.

Capacități tehnice și arhitectură Qwen3-Coder

Qwen3-Coder poate susține întregul ciclu de dezvoltare a software-ului. Poate proiecta module de aplicații, crea teste unitare și explica raționamentul său pas cu pas. Prin urmare, este util pentru sarcini de programare complexe în care precizia și claritatea sunt necesare.

Modelul se bazează pe o arhitectură Mixture-of-Experts (MoE). În acest design, doar o parte a parametrilor este activată în timpul inferenței. Acest lucru îmbunătățește eficiența, menținând în același timp o performanță ridicată.

Qwen3-Coder suportă, de asemenea, ferestre de context foarte lungi. În mod implicit, poate gestiona până la 256.000 de tokeni, iar cu metode de extrapolare, această capacitate poate fi extinsă la 1 milion de tokeni. Acestă funcție permite modelului să proceseze baze de cod mari și să urmărească dependențe între multiple fișiere. Mai mult, o face potrivită pentru sisteme enterprise care necesită o înțelegere largă a modulelor interconectate.

Învățarea prin întărire este un alt aspect important al antrenamentului său. Îmbunătățește capacitatea modelului de a urma instrucțiuni și reduce erorile în codul generat. În plus, Qwen3-Coder suportă fluxuri de lucru multi-agente. De exemplu, un agent poate genera codul principal, altul poate testa, iar al treilea poate pregăti documentația. Prin urmare, sistemul funcționează ca un ecosistem de codare, mai degrabă decât un instrument singular.

Integrarea cu mediile de dezvoltare a fost, de asemenea, accentuată. Qwen3-Coder lucrează cu IDE-uri utilizate în mod obișnuit, cum ar fi Visual Studio Code. Dezvoltatorii pot, prin urmare, genera, testa și depana codul fără a părăsi spațiul de lucru familiar. De asemenea, suportă o gamă largă de limbi de programare, inclusiv Python, JavaScript, Java, C++, Go și Rust. Această diversitate crește valoarea sa pentru dezvoltarea web, aplicații enterprise și sisteme încorporate.

În general, Qwen3-Coder combină eficiența, adaptabilitatea și funcționalitatea largă. Poate susține atât dezvoltatori individuali, cât și echipe mai mari implicate în proiecte din lumea reală.

Benchmark-uri și performanță

Rezultatele benchmark-urilor arată că modelul Qwen3-Coder se numără printre cele mai bune modele open-source. Pe SWE-Bench Verified, versiunea Qwen3-Coder-480B-A35B-Instruct a obținut 55,40% rezolvate. Acest benchmark măsoară cât de bine un model poate repara bug-uri în proiecte open-source reale.

Deși unele modele comerciale închise obțin scoruri mai mari, cum ar fi Claude 4 Opus la 67,60% și GPT-5 la 65,00%, Qwen3-Coder este unul dintre cele mai bune modele de codare open-source disponibile. Acest lucru este important pentru dezvoltatorii care preferă instrumente AI transparente și modificabile.

Performanța depinde, de asemenea, de eficiență, nu doar de acuratețe. Alibaba a proiectat Qwen3-Coder pentru a îmbunătăți viteza de inferență, ceea ce reduce timpul necesar pentru finalizarea sarcinilor. Prin urmare, dezvoltatorii care lucrează la proiecte de scară largă pot economisi ore atunci când generează sau testează cod.

În ceea ce privește alternativele, Qwen3-Coder oferă o combinație echilibrată de acuratețe, deschidere și eficiență. GPT-4o de la OpenAI oferă o acuratețe puternică, dar este închis și necesită plată. Claude 3.5 de la Anthropic se descurcă bine, dar nu este open-source. DeepSeek Coder este cunoscut pentru viteza sa, dar oferă mai puțină flexibilitate. În schimb, Qwen3-Coder oferă dezvoltatorilor o acuratețe competitivă, rămânând în același timp gratuit accesibil.

Mai mult, testele interne ale lui Alibaba au arătat că Qwen3-Coder a rezolvat adesea bug-uri legacy cu mai puține încercări decât alte modele. Această funcție este valoroasă în medii profesionale, deoarece rezolvarea rapidă a unei probleme poate preveni întârzieri lungi de proiect.

Aplicații în lumea reală

Qwen3-Coder are o utilizare practică în dezvoltarea de software, nu doar în cercetare sau testare.

Dezvoltare web

Poate genera atât codul front-end, cât și cel back-end. Dezvoltatorii descriu funcția în cuvinte simple, iar modelul creează componente funcționale utilizând cadre cum ar fi React, Node.js sau HTML/CSS. Acest lucru ajută la prototiparea mai rapidă și reduce munca de codare repetitivă.

Debogare și cod legacy

Poate scana baze de cod mari și indica erori logice. Multe organizații depind încă de sisteme legacy, care sunt lente și greu de reparat manual. Qwen3-Coder face acest proces mai rapid și reduce șansele de greșeli.

DevOps și automatizare

Poate scrie scripturi pentru implementare, monitorizare și configurare a sistemului. Automatizarea acestor sarcini economisește efortul manual și îmbunătățește fiabilitatea. De asemenea, funcționează bine cu instrumente cum ar fi GitHub și VS Code, ceea ce o face utilă în fluxurile de lucru DevOps moderne.

Educație și învățare

Qwen3-Coder poate explica concepte de programare pas cu pas. De asemenea, poate ghida studenții prin proiecte mici sau arăta cum funcționează algoritmii. Acest lucru îl face util ca asistent de predare în educația de codare.

Securitate și revizuire de cod

Poate susține testarea de securitate de bază. Modelul revizuiește codul pentru vulnerabilități, sugerează remedii și poate simula modele de atac. Această funcție este încă în curs de dezvoltare, dar arată cum astfel de instrumente pot ajuta la practici de dezvoltare sigure.

Tabelul 1: Qwen3-Coder vs GPT-4o vs Claude 3.5 vs DeepSeek-Coder

Caz de utilizare Qwen3-Coder GPT-4o Claude 3.5 DeepSeek-Coder
Dezvoltare web Da – suportă React, Node.js, generare HTML/CSS Da – generare de cod puternic, dar închis Da – bună cu raționamentul multi-pas Da – rapid, dar suport limitat pentru cadre
Debogare cod legacy Da – scanează baze de cod mari, urmărește dependențe Da – precis, dar mai lent pe fișiere mari Da – bună cu raționamentul, mai lent pe sisteme legacy Limitat – mai rapid, dar mai puțin precis
Automatizare DevOps Da – scrie scripturi de implementare, suportă instrumente CLI Da – prin API, nu local Limitat – lipsește integrarea completă CLI Da – scriptare rapidă, utilizare limitată a instrumentelor
Educație și predare Da – explică concepte pas cu pas, suportă prezentări de proiecte Da – explicații bune, nu personalizabile Da – puternic în logică și claritate Limitat – rapid, dar nu detaliat
Testare de securitate În curs de dezvoltare – revizuiește codul, simulează modele de atac Nu – nu a fost proiectat pentru sarcini de securitate Nu – lipsește funcționalități axate pe securitate Nu – nu este potrivit pentru testarea securității
Integrare cu instrumente Da – funcționează cu VS Code, GitHub, Qwen CLI Nu – doar API Nu – suport limitat pentru instrumente externe Da – suport de bază CLI
Open-source Complet deschis sub licența Apache 2.0 Închis Închis Parțial deschis, cu greutăți limitate
Poate rula local Da – prin Hugging Face sau găzduire personalizată Nu Nu Suport local limitat
Utilizare comercială Gratuit pentru utilizare comercială API plătită Restrictivă Licențiere mixtă

Tendințe de piață și poziționare strategică în 2025

Piața asistenților de codare AI rămâne foarte competitivă în 2025. Companiile lider au introdus modele avansate, cum ar fi GPT-4o de la OpenAI, Code Llama de la Meta și Claude 3.5 Sonnet de la Anthropic. Alți jucători, inclusiv DeepSeek, se concentrează pe soluții de codare mai specializate. Fiecare model aduce forțe diferite pe piață.

Sondajele recente ale dezvoltatorilor confirmă o mișcare clară către instrumente open-source. Sondajul dezvoltatorilor Stack Overflow din 2025 subliniază această tendință. Mulți dezvoltatori aleg acum modele open-source, deoarece oferă transparență, costuri mai mici și o libertate mai mare de personalizare. Deși sistemele comerciale încă performează puternic în mai multe benchmark-uri, alternativele open-source continuă să câștige încredere și adoptare mai largă.

Lansarea Qwen3-Coder ca model open-source sub licența Apache 2.0 consolidează rolul lui Alibaba pe piață. Acest lucru face modelul atât un competitor global, cât și domestic, susținând cererea în creștere pentru instrumente AI flexibile și transparente.

Qwen3-Coder se integrează, de asemenea, cu ușurință în fluxurile de lucru de dezvoltare existente. Oferă o performanță solidă, compatibilitate cu instrumente comune și control deplin pentru dezvoltatori. Această combinație îl face o alegere practică pentru echipele care caută suport de codare AI fiabil, fără limitări de la furnizori.

Concluzia

Qwen3-Coder demonstrează cum AI-ul open-source poate juca un rol central în dezvoltarea de software. Combina funcții de codare puternice cu eficiență, integrare cu instrumente și suport lingvistic larg. Mai mult, disponibilitatea sa open-source sub licența Apache 2.0 îl diferențiază de multe sisteme comerciale închise, oferind dezvoltatorilor atât flexibilitate, cât și control. Benchmark-urile confirmă că performează competitiv, oferind beneficii practice, cum ar fi depanarea mai rapidă, automatizarea și suportul educațional.

În mod similar, capacitatea sa de a gestiona baze de cod foarte mari și de a permite fluxuri de lucru multi-agente evidențiază noi posibilități în programarea colaborativă. Într-o piață în care încrederea, transparența și adaptabilitatea contează la fel de mult ca acuratețea, Qwen3-Coder oferă o opțiune echilibrată. Pentru dezvoltatori, educatorii și organizațiile, reprezintă un pas practic înainte în direcția transformării AI-ului într-un partener eficient în codare.

Dr. Assad Abbas, un profesor asociat titular la Universitatea COMSATS Islamabad, Pakistan, a obținut doctoratul de la Universitatea de Stat din Dakota de Nord, USA. Cercetările sale se axează pe tehnologii avansate, inclusiv calculul în cloud, fog și edge, analiza datelor mari și inteligența artificială. Dr. Abbas a făcut contribuții substanțiale prin publicații în reviste științifice și conferințe reputabile. El este, de asemenea, fondatorul MyFastingBuddy.